Erigeron linearis
Linearleaf Fleabane has unbranched stems that are 5-30 cm tall and which arise from a stout taproot and branched rootcrown. The mostly basal leaves are linear and 1-9 cm long. The bases of the stems and leaves are enlarged and straw-colored or purplish, and the herbage is covered with fine gray hairs. The flower heads are usually solitary at the ends of the stems.
